Unlocking the Global Space Economy

In 2024, the world witnessed a record $613 billion in space revenues, marking a 7.8% increase over the previous year. This surge reflects the growing influence of private enterprises alongside traditional government agencies.

Commercial players now account for 78% of total space activity, with revenues soaring to $480 billion. Governments contribute the remaining 22%, investing in national security, exploration, and scientific research.

Commercial Sector Innovations Driving Growth

The commercial segment is powered by pioneering sub-sectors, each leveraging space-enabled technologies to transform life on Earth:

  • Satellite communications and broadband networks are expanding global connectivity, bridging digital divides and enabling real-time data exchange.
  • Earth observation and geospatial analytics deliver daily high-resolution imagery for agriculture, climate monitoring, and disaster response.
  • Launch services and reusable rockets have driven costs down, catalyzing 149 orbital launches in the first half of 2025—an all-time high.
  • Lunar infrastructure and payload delivery initiatives are laying the groundwork for a nascent Moon economy, with multiple commercial landers scheduled to touch down before the decade’s end.

By 2035, analysts project the space economy could reach up to $1.8 trillion, fueled by applications in agriculture, finance, insurance, and consumer services. These projections account for a steady 9% annual growth rate, driven by space-enabled technology integration.

Government and NASA Contributions

Governments remain pivotal partners in this revolution. In 2023, the United States allocated $77 billion to civil and national security space programs—the highest investment worldwide. This funding generated:

  • $75.6 billion in economic output through NASA’s activities, supporting research, manufacturing, and operations.
  • $27.6 billion in labor income, benefiting communities across multiple states.

Increasingly, agencies are forging dual-use partnerships, leveraging commercial platforms for defense and scientific missions alike. Programs like NASA’s Commercial Lunar Payload Services (CLPS) demonstrate how public-private collaboration can accelerate exploration and reduce costs.

Regional and Workforce Transformations

Space commercialization is not confined to traditional hubs. Regions such as Washington State have observed dramatic growth, generating $4.6 billion in economic activity and supporting over 13,000 jobs in 2021 alone.

A younger, tech-savvy workforce is entering the industry, drawn by the promise of innovation and the allure of discovery. Employment trends in manufacturing, information technology, and transportation reflect this shift, as new companies establish operations near launch sites and production facilities.

Challenges and Emerging Opportunities

Despite the promise, the space economy faces headwinds. Geopolitical tensions and protectionist policies could restrict technology exchange and market access. Execution risks in complex missions, supply chain bottlenecks, and launch failures remain concerns for investors.

Yet, opportunities abound. Integration of AI with Earth observation data promises breakthroughs in climate resilience and precision agriculture. In-orbit manufacturing and assembly could yield high-value pharmaceuticals and advanced materials.

Next-generation space stations and lunar bases open new frontiers for research, tourism, and commerce. Sovereign-commercial partnerships are set to expand, combining government expertise with private innovation to tackle grand challenges.
